You could screw on a 55mm round filter both from SRP to the macro filter. We were using the SRP urpro filter with the +10.

The focus distance with macromini is so close that really a light is a must. I found that with color filter, lights cause the image to be washed out w red.

But having tried both flip & SRP filters at different depth down to 35M recently w different lighting condition. I second that both filter system is highly dependent to depth & light. On deeper or darker dives, sometime our Gopro4 could not adjust to color correct. One fix is first aim the camera to brighter area such as sun above then shoot.
